Pedestrian killed in Vreed-en-Hoop accident

Police are investigating an accident which occurred at about 1.30 am yesterday on New Road, Vreed-en-Hoop, West Coast Demerara and which resulted in the death of pedestrian Barrat Persaud.  In a statement, the police said that the accident involved a hire car (registration #HD 3236) owned by Zaman Alladin and driven at the time by 45-year-old Jermaine Wallerson and pedestrian Barrat Persaud, a 50-year-old of no fixed place of abode.

New child court opens at Wales

A new Children’s Court and Child-Friendly Room was commissioned on Thursday at Wales, West Bank Demerara, Region Three, according to the Department of Public Information (DPI).

Massy Stores opens at Giftland Mall

Massy Stores Guyana yesterday opened a branch at the Giftland Mall in Liliendaal – its sixth – taking over from FoodMaxx which closed their doors on May 27.

OPEC+ extends deep oil production cuts into 2025

LONDON/DUBAI, (Reuters) – OPEC+ agreed today to extend most of its deep oil output cuts for 2024 but to start phasing them out in 2025, as the group seeks to shore up the market amid tepid global demand growth, high interest rates and rising rival U.S.

Modi’s alliance to win big in India election, exit polls project

NEW DELHI, (Reuters) –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P)-led alliance is projected to win a big majority in the general election that concluded yesterday, TV exit polls said, suggesting it would do better than expected by most analysts.
